Output 377a142762d97bf7c4d79cc4247cc5789c2ae63cb8e3059be2a266b2823db64a:5

value
29990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ad8a5c3ef6100572de39a92b10d33e1cab075c7 OP_EQUAL
address
35bZqXwb4CAvGJrinyTx1XQyP7PWoNgVgG
transaction
377a142762d97bf7c4d79cc4247cc5789c2ae63cb8e3059be2a266b2823db64a
spent
true